Financial Aid


Need help paying for child care? Consider applying for subsidized child care.

The subsidized child care program helps low-income families pay their child care fees. 
The state and federal governments fund this program, which is managed by the Child Care Information Services (CCIS) located in your county. If you meet the guidelines,

  • The CCIS will pay a part of your child care fee (called a subsidy payment).
  • You will pay a part of the fee (called a family co-pay).
  • The subsidy payment and the family co-pay go directly to the child care program. The CCIS office is the center for child care information and child care help in your county. You can call or visit the CCIS office for a subsidized child care application. The following are the basic guidelines for subsidized child care:
  • You must live in Pennsylvania
  • Have a child or children who need child care while you work or attend an educational program
  • Meet income guidelines for your family size
  • Work 20 or more hours a week –or-
  • Work 10 hours and train 10 hours a week
  • Have a promise of a job that will start within 30 days of your application for subsidized child care
  • Teen parents must attend an educational program

    LVCC Scholarship Fund

    The LVCC Scholarship Fund benefits low-income, working families who are eligible for government child care subsidies and are waiting for a subsidy to become available. 
    Help is also available to pursue vocational training or to handle a family crisis. 
    To be considered for scholarship assistance, you must
  • have a child or children currently enrolled in a LVCC Center
  • show proof that you have applied for a state subsidy
  • complete a Scholarship Fund application (available from the director at your child’s center) and return it to the center director with the required documentation.
